
Introduction: What is vibe coding?
Vibe coding is more than just another tech trend - it's a new way of developing software in which modern AI models (e.g. Claude from Anthropic or ChatGPT) transform the creative and technical process of coding.
Instead of traditional programming methods, where the code base, logic and structure have to be built manually, vibe coding enables a more intuitive, emotional and assisted approach - with the aim of quickly creating a functioning app or website from a vision.
Whether you're a beginner or an experienced developer, the combination of powerful AI tools, voice-based interaction and fast resources makes the coding experience more accessible for everyone. A sense of flow, creativity and efficiency play a central role in this.

The idea behind Vibe Coding: more flow, less code
The term vibe coding was coined by Andrej Karpathy - one of the best-known minds in the field of modern AI technologies. His vision: a new mode of programming in which artificial intelligence (AI) is not just a tool, but a true team partner in the development of digital solutions.
The central idea is that everyone should have access to app creation - without any previous knowledge of coding. AI support helps to analyze tasks, design functions and generate code in natural language. This creates an environment in which not only technology, but also a feeling for structure, content and design counts.
Vibe Coding is therefore a real game changer in the way we think about projects, tools and software. Instead of getting lost in complex blocks of code, the focus is on the creative experience - with the intelligence of AI in the background.

The Vibe coding process: from the idea to the finished app
๐ง 3.1 Define idea & vision
Every app development starts with a vision - be it a productivity solution, a booking tool or a creative website. Vibe Coding makes this first phase particularly intuitive: instead of complex planning processes, a simple description in natural language suffices.
Example: "I want to create an app that allows users to book appointments."
This input alone is enough for modern AI models such as Claude or ChatGPT to develop initial logical structures.
โ๏ธ 3.2 UI Design & Components with V0
V0 - a revolutionary app builder from Vercel - allows you to generate design ideas directly from text prompts. You describe your app components (e.g. button, calendar, form), and V0 automatically creates the appropriate front-end layout.
An initial visual prototype is created without the need for programming, which can be tested and adapted immediately. This not only saves time, but also reduces typical errors in the early stages of development.

๐ฌ 3.3 Logic & data modeling with Claude AI
Claude, Anthropic's AI flagship, does more than just text processing: it can help you design logic, data structures, APIs and functions. You can ask Claude in natural language:
"How do I process a form request in my app?" - and immediately receive suitable code blocks, explanations and alternatives.
This is a real introduction to the world of programming, especially for beginners, without getting lost in complex syntax.
๐๏ธ 3.4 Backend & data with Supabase
For example, Supabase - a powerful no-code backend - is used for database management and authentication. It can be easily combined with V0 or Claude-generated components so that the entire app can be operated from a single workflow.
The use of tools such as Supabase enables automated resource management, real-time data access and authentication - without in-depth backend knowledge.

๐งช 3.5 Testing, publishing & iterating
With a functional prototype, you can carry out tests directly - either with real users or AI-supported test feedback. Many tools support the creation of test cases automatically.
Once the app is ready, it is published - depending on the project - on platforms such as Vercel, Netlify or the App Store.
Thanks to Vibe Coding, this entire development process is no longer months of work in a team, but an agile flow that often leads to a result in just a few days.
Summary of the process:
Top tools in the Vibe Coding Stack (2025)
At the heart of the Vibe Coding approach are modern AI tools that support the entire development process - from the initial idea to the finished application. Each tool fulfills a specific function and is an important part of an efficient workflow.
โ๏ธ Claude (Anthropic)
A real all-rounder among AI models: Claude provides support in brainstorming, writing logic, correcting errors in code, querying data or automating entire applications.
Even beginners can solve complex technical problems using natural language - Claude provides suitable suggestions, insights and directly executable solutions.
๐ง V0 from Vercel
V0 is a visual frontend tool that creates complete layouts via prompt input - directly in the right format for React or HTML. It eliminates tedious pixel pushing and gives you instant access to functional UI components.
Particularly helpful for the rapid implementation of MVPs or presentations.

๐ง ChatGPT (OpenAI)
For many, it is the ideal introduction to the world of programming. As a universal helper, ChatGPT offers assistance with syntax, code suggestions, structuring and logical organization. It is an indispensable tool, especially when designing projects, small scripts or learning new technologies.
๐งฉ Cursor, Codeium, Replit Ghostwriter
These tools extend classic code editors with AI functions such as automatic error correction, block understanding or direct code generation from text. You type a comment - the tool writes the code.
Such editors are useful for anyone who already has a certain level of technical expertise but does not want to set up a complete environment themselves.
๐ Supabase
As an open source alternative to Firebase, Supabase offers database, authentication, API and hosting in a single system. You can manage user logins via email address, data models via interface and role rights centrally.
Particularly valuable for applications with sensitive data and clearly defined access concepts.
๐ผ๏ธ Tool table at a glance
Example: Your workflow could look like this
To make the concept of vibe coding tangible, we show you an example of the process - from the idea to the functional application. Imagine you want to create a small app that allows users to book appointments.
๐งญ Step 1: Introduction and description of the topic
You start with a simple text description in Claude or ChatGPT:
"Create an app that allows users to select and book appointments using a form. The app should send a confirmation by email."
This is how you get started with the project - without any knowledge of code. The AI automatically recognizes the topic and structures the first logical processes.
๐จ Step 2: Generate UI layout with V0
Now open V0 and enter the same description. The tool immediately creates a visual image of the interface: calendar, input field, confirmation page - in the correct format.
You have direct access to the source code, can make changes or add new UI elements. The UI is automatically responsive and accessible.

๐ง Step 3: Refine logic & code with Claude
Now you take over Claude again, e.g. to define the backend handling:
- What happens after I submit the form?
- What data is stored?
- How is the confirmation e-mail address transmitted?
Claude generates the appropriate code block for this and suggests additional functions or validations. Errors in the structure? Claude recognizes them and provides help to correct them.
๐ Step 4: Test & iterate in a protected space
Thanks to these tools, you work in a controlled digital space where you can experiment freely. You can play with different versions of your app, test them directly and receive immediate feedback.
Some developer tools even offer visual test feedback - i.e. automated insights into whether the app is working as desired or where there are still problems.

๐ Step 5: Publishing & sharing the project
Finally, you can document your project in an article or blog post - e.g. "How I built my first app with Vibe Coding".
Publishing is done via Vercel or Netlify, for example - or you give your team access via GitHub. All without classic software development in the traditional sense - but through creative interactions with intelligent technology.
Advantages of Vibe Coding for developers & start-ups
๐ Faster from the idea to the product
One of the biggest advantages of vibe coding is its speed: instead of investing weeks or months in traditional software development, an idea can be turned into a clickable prototype in just a few hours.
This is an invaluable advantage, especially for start-ups with limited resources or high time-to-market requirements.
๐งฉ No code? No problem
With Vibe Coding, even users who have no prior knowledge of programming can actively participate in digital projects. AI takes on many of the complex tasks - from writing code and logic to generating UI elements.
In this way, software development becomes a creative experience in which people set the vision and the intelligence of the machine implements it.
๐ง Better solutions through human + machine collaboration
AI-supported development often leads to surprisingly elegant solutions. The AI tools provide suggestions, discover patterns, avoid errors and automatically improve the structure - while the developer sets the direction.
This role of humans as creative leaders makes Vibe Coding a hybrid mode of the future - a real team game.

๐ Democratization of technology worldwide
Thanks to its ease of use, low entry costs and the removal of technical barriers, technology is becoming more accessible worldwide. Whether in Berlin, Lagos or Sรฃo Paulo - anyone with an idea and internet access can now build.
Vibe Coding is changing access to the digital world - and opening doors for a new generation of applications, tools and ideas.
๐ก A new component of digital work
Vibe coding is not a replacement for traditional programming, but a new component of modern work. It helps to get started faster, validate ideas and bring teams with different backgrounds together effectively.
Whether you are an experienced developer, startup founder or curious beginner - Vibe Coding offers you help, structure and plenty of creative freedom.
Conclusion & outlook: The future of app development
Vibe coding is far more than just a passing trend - it's a new approach that is changing the way we think about digital products for good.
AI support, intuitive access to tools such as Claude, V0 or Supabase and seamless interaction between man and machine significantly lower the hurdle to app creation.
๐ฎ Where does the path lead?
In the coming years, the mode of programming will continue to change. Developers will be less concerned with syntax errors and boilerplate code - and more with concept, structure and user experience.
AI will increasingly act as a creative partner that provides insights, proactively recognizes problems and makes suggestions before they are needed.

๐ A topic for everyone - not just developers
The topic of vibe coding not only affects professional teams, but everyone who works with digital content:
- Designers who want to turn an image into a UI layout
- Authors who incorporate their ideas into interactive applications
- Startups that need prototypes faster
- Individuals who want to design their first website
Vibe Coding is an entry point into the world of digital creation, regardless of background or skill level.
๐ฌ Final thought
Vibe Coding is not just a tool - it is a new format that brings together creativity, technology and human imagination. It is a space in which ideas grow, data flows and digital projects come to life.
Whether as a playground, learning environment or real productivity booster: Vibe Coding is here to stay.
Your app idea won't wait - get started with ogiX Digital
Do you have an idea and want to turn it into a finished application quickly and efficiently? We combine modern technologies, AI-supported tools and in-depth expertise to develop exactly the right app for you.
๐ Discover our service:
Web development & app creation - customized solutions for your business
Let's turn your project into reality together - Vibe Coding style.